Hawkeye is a city located in Fayette County, Iowa. Hawkeye has a 2025 population of 423. Hawkeye is currently declining at a rate of -0.7% annually and its population has decreased by -3.2% since the most recent census, which recorded a population of 437 in 2020.

The average household income in Hawkeye is $69,442 with a poverty rate of 3.45%. The median age in Hawkeye is 38.1 years: 38.9 years for males, and 35.1 years for females.

Demographics

The racial composition of Hawkeye includes 90.79% White, and smaller percentages for Black or African American, other race, Native American, Asian,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ander and multiracial populations.

Economics and Income Statistics

Hawkeye's average per capita income is $39,609. Household income levels show a median of $62,917. The poverty rate stands at 3.45%.

Families: A family includes the owner or renter of the home along with everyone related to them - whether through birth, marriage, or adoption. This includes relatives like spouses, children, parents, siblings, grandparents, and any other family members.
Households: A household includes all the people who occupy a housing unit (such as a house or apartment) as their usual place of residence.
Non Families: A nonfamily household is either someone living alone or when the owner/renter lives with people they aren't related to, like roommates.
